A popular Ely pub has reopened following a £262,000 facelift.
Ten new jobs have been created at Market Street venue The Hereward, which reopened to the public last Friday.
The pub is managed by Dave and Wendy Smith and welcomed fire eaters and jugglers – as well as the mayor of Ely, Councillor Lis Every - for its grand re-opening event.
Mr Smith said: “We will continue to offer great service and a quality food and drink offer.”
The pub is continuing with its cask ale selection with Greene King IPA on permanently and another four rotating local ales.
The pub will open from 10am-11pm Monday to Thursday, 10am-1am on Friday and Saturday and midday to 11pm on Sunday.
